1. Meadow Vale Retreats, Screveton (from USD 138)

If you’re on a self-drive holiday, you’ll appreciate the free parking that comes with this property. Located 22 km (14 mi) from Nottingham, Meadow Vale Retreats offers four tents that can sleep between two and four people. Each tent is self-contained, so you’ll have your own entrance plus everything you need for a comfortable stay.

The tents are set within a meadow, which means that you’ll wake up to a beautiful view of the countryside each morning. Around a 30-minute drive away is Nottingham city centre, where you can enjoy fine dining, shopping or visiting art galleries and museums.

2. DiVine, Hucknall (from USD 113)

If you’re travelling alone or with a friend, this dome may be just what you need. Offering a beautiful, forested view, DiVine is located in a peaceful area outside Hucknall. The facilities inside the dome include a double bed, heating, lighting and electrical points. You’ll also have access to the shower and toilet, 30 m (98 ft) away from the dome. This is perfect if you’re looking to rough it out a little in such pretty surroundings.

The rental also offers free parking. You can roam around Hucknall since it’s just a five-minute drive from the property. In this town, you’ll find a great mix of restaurants, bars and shops. There are supermarkets too, where you can get supplies to spend a day picnicking in one of the surrounding fields or have a barbecue by DiVine’s firepit at night.

3. Bell Tent Village, Nottingham (from USD 136)

Sporty types will appreciate this tented camp, located at the Holme Pierrepont Country Park campsite. There’s a cricket ground, water sports centre and cycling trails nearby. For those who are into power walking, you can roam around the garden in the area. If your group is large, you may opt for the Large Deluxe Tent that can accommodate up to 16 guests. Otherwise, a choice of two other tents that can sleep up to four or five guests is also available. The tents have sleeping and relaxing areas, while the shower and toilet are nearby.

If sports aren’t your cup of tea, you can opt for a 20-minute drive to Nottingham to explore historic sites such as Nottingham Castle.

4. The White Dove, Coddington (from USD 170)

When you arrive at this rental, you’ll be greeted by either Sheila, the proprietor, or a member of her three-person team, setting the tone for what promises to be a hospitable stay. You’ll be shown around the property, a highlight of which is sure to be each bell tent’s hot tub. There are two tents to choose from, and both have everything you need for a comfortable stay, including a fully equipped kitchenette and fire pit.

The town of Newark is a 10-minute drive away. Wednesdays and Saturdays are market days, which means you can shop for locally made items. There are also boutiques to browse, Newark Castle to explore and a riverside where you can stroll along.
